My 15 year old Starbucks (Saeco) espresso machine was taking forever to make a long espresso, so I finally decided to do something about it. It turned out that the portafilter basket was about 90% clogged with old grounds. So I found a needle and started punching out each hole. Realizing that this was going to take forever, I found the following suggestion

The pin-holes are plugged with coffee fibre, which burns. Place the filter over a gas flame, either side, for 10 minutes, tapping it with tongs occasionally, and bingo... A CLEAN FILTER. All the minute coffee fibre plugs burn or pop out. Best to use a small coffee pot rack on top of your smallest hob gas burner for this. And metal tongs.
|
I gave it a try and it really worked and took no more than 5 minutes.
